I remember seeing Silver Horizon ( ex CB&Q 375 / ex Amtrak 9250) used as the station in Maricopa Arizona. This unique car, I believe was one of seven cars, ( 4 for the Burlington, 2 for the Western Pacific and 1 for the Rio Grande ), that were used on the California Zephyr, and were built as three double bedroom, 1 drawing room, dome, lounge observation cars back in 1948 by Budd.

Later I heard , the car was no longer being used as the Amtrak station in Maricopa ( outside of Phoenix ) and was moved to a vacant lot, where some talk was being done regarding hte car's future. I believe there was some talk about the city using the car in a park, or selling the car to a museum ?

Anyone know the current story ? Also .. I know the Silver Crescent is in Miami, Sivler Solarium is still running, Silver Lookout is up in North Dakota... Where are the other 3... Is one of the cars owned by the BNSF at their headquarters in Texas ?? Did the NYSW have one ??

Silver Sky (D&RGW): Now in Saginaw, MI under private ownership to be restored to charter service after being left stripped and neglected by VIA for many years.

Silver Penthouse (CB&Q): Now landlocked and extensively remodeled as a "deli car" at BNSF HQ in Ft. Worth, TX., renamed "Prarie View". I guess "Silver Penthouse" was too racy a name.

Silver Planet (WP): Last reported to be in private charter service in Mexico under the name 'San Luis'.

SILVER RIDGE is preserved at IRM in Union, IL in operating condition. It was one of the cars sent to Chicago for filming of Flag of our Fathers.
